
On January 27, Aliko Dangote, President and CEO of Nigeria’s Dangote Group, led a delegation on a field visit to XCMG Group. He held in-depth discussions with Yang Dongsheng, Chairman of both XCMG Group and XCMG Machinery and Secretary of the Party Committee, alongside other senior executives.
Yang Dongsheng warmly welcomed Mr. Dangote and his delegation. He provided a systematic overview of XCMG’s transformation journey, strategic layout, and latest achievements in its “Five Modernizations” initiative (focused on intelligent, green, and other transformative upgrades). Yang also expressed appreciation for Dangote Group’s longstanding contributions to advancing industrialization in Africa. Aliko Dangote commended XCMG’s global strategy, smart manufacturing capabilities, equipment reliability, and lifecycle service support. On site, the two sides reached consensus on supporting Africa’s sustainable development goals and advancing energy transition strategies.

About Dangote Group
Dangote Group is one of Africa’s largest, most diversified, and most influential industrial conglomerates. Headquartered in Lagos, Nigeria, its business covers sectors including cement, sugar, salt, agriculture, logistics, oil and gas, and construction. With operations in over ten African countries—such as Nigeria, Ethiopia, Senegal, Zambia, Ghana, and Tanzania—the group plays a pivotal role in driving industrialization and promoting regional self-sufficiency across the continent.
